~alan-griffiths/mir/add-mir_surface_spec_attach

Viewing all changes in revision 3593.

  • Committer: Tarmac
  • Author(s): Daniel van Vugt
  • Date: 2016-07-15 08:27:46 UTC
  • mfrom: (3592.1.1 odr)
  • Revision ID: tarmac-20160715082746-b2k6q04rrql80qwm
Fix build/autolanding failure due to ODR violation in MockEGL
(LP: #1603303)

Since /usr/include/EGL/eglplatform.h is full of #ifdefs and the Mir
source uses multiple different interpretations of those #ifdefs,
we can't safely define any C++ class that accepts the Native* types
as parameters.
. Fixes: https://bugs.launchpad.net/bugs/1603303.

Approved by Daniel van Vugt, mir-ci-bot.

expand all expand all

Show diffs side-by-side

added added

removed removed

Lines of Context: